## Releases

Before cutting a release of Larkspur Gateway, verify the staging resolver is healthy. We have an intermittent DNS resolution failure against the internal mirror in the Veldt region: retries usually succeed, but a failed lookup mid-upload can corrupt the manifest. Pin the mirror IP in `/etc/hosts` on the build runner, run `larkctl preflight --dns`, and only then sign the artifact with the key that follows.

signing key of bagap-yawep = bky13_TbfT6ZMUoGJo2

### Changelog — CrashFunnel 3.2 (defaults changed)

CrashFunnel, the mobile crash-report pipeline, ships new defaults this week. Batch upload interval drops from 60s to 15s, symbolication retries raised to 5, and sampling on low-severity crashes is now on by default. Teams relying on the old unsampled feed must opt out explicitly before Thursday's deploy. Dashboards may show a brief dip in raw event counts; this is expected. The new default configuration shipped with 3.2 is as follows.

deployment values, yadug-bawif:
[framir]
team = pelox
access_code = ac_a38ab2
owner = tamion.julael
host = framir.tolvaqlabs.test
port = 11211
peer = tammir.zemvargrid.local
salt = 2215ef03
pin = 1541

**Ticket: Solver assigns double-booked labs on Wednesdays.** The Chalkmere timetable solver occasionally places two cohorts in the same lab when a teacher swap occurs mid-week. New team members: reproduce with the Hollowfen sample dataset, seed 12, and check the constraint log carefully. The reproducing build is recorded below for reference.

build token for kagaf-hahof: htk14_9d3d4d26d7d8de

Handover — donation-receipt mailer (Givewell... no, Almsly). Mailer stalled Friday; queue backed up ~4k receipts. Cleared most of it, ~300 still retrying due to template errors. Support will get duplicate-receipt complaints — dedupe script is in the tools repo, runs idempotently. Don't restart the worker pool during business hours. The retry console is locked; unlock it with the recovery passphrase below.

vault phrase of bagaf-kajeg = jorath-feniel-briir-siliel-ralix